About James Kauderer

James Kauderer is a scholar working on Obstetrics and Gynecology, Reproductive Medicine, Oncology, Pathology and Forensic Medicine and Epidemiology, having authored 25 papers that have together received 1.2k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Endometrial and Cervical Cancer Treatments (12 papers), Ovarian cancer diagnosis and treatment (10 papers), Lymphatic System and Diseases (5 papers), Cervical Cancer and HPV Research (4 papers), Endometriosis Research and Treatment (4 papers), Cancer survivorship and care (3 papers), Uterine Myomas and Treatments (3 papers) and Systemic Sclerosis and Related Diseases (3 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Obstetrics and Gynecology (794 citations), Reproductive Medicine (567 citations), Oncology (246 citations), Epidemiology (187 citations) and Cancer Research (73 citations). James Kauderer has collaborated with scholars based in United States, Japan and Norway. Frequent co-authors include John P. Curtin, Cornelia L. Trimble, Peter Lim, Richard J. Zaino, David S. Alberts, Steven M. Silverberg, James J. Burke, Joan L. Walker, Donald G. Gallup and Steven G. Silverberg. Their work appears in journals such as Gynecologic Oncology, Cancer, British Journal of Cancer, International Journal of Gynecological Cancer and Menopause The Journal of The North American Menopause Society.
